Mantis安装说明 - 图文 联系客服

发布时间 : 星期四 文章Mantis安装说明 - 图文更新完毕开始阅读1b523aa8b84ae45c3a358c08

idINTEGER UNSIGNED NOTNULL AUTO_INCREMENT, bug_idINTEGER UNSIGNED NOTNULLDEFAULT 0, reporter_idINTEGER UNSIGNED NOTNULLDEFAULT 0, bugnote_text_idINTEGER UNSIGNED NOTNULLDEFAULT 0, view_stateSMALLINTNOTNULLDEFAULT 10,

date_submitted DATETIME NOTNULLDEFAULT'1970-01-01 00:00:01', last_modified DATETIME NOTNULLDEFAULT'1970-01-01 00:00:01', note_typeINTEGERDEFAULT 0, note_attrVARCHAR(250) DEFAULT'', PRIMARYKEY (id)

)ENGINE=MyISAM DEFAULT CHARSET=utf8;

ALTERTABLE mantis_bugnote_table ADDINDEX idx_bug (bug_id);

ALTERTABLE mantis_bugnote_table ADDINDEX idx_last_mod (last_modified);

CREATETABLE mantis_bugnote_text_table ( idINTEGER UNSIGNED NOTNULL AUTO_INCREMENT, note LONGTEXT NOTNULL, PRIMARYKEY (id)

)ENGINE=MyISAM DEFAULT CHARSET=utf8;

CREATETABLE mantis_custom_field_project_table ( field_idINTEGERNOTNULLDEFAULT 0,

project_idINTEGER UNSIGNED NOTNULLDEFAULT 0, sequenceSMALLINTNOTNULLDEFAULT 0, PRIMARYKEY (field_id, project_id) )ENGINE=MyISAM DEFAULT CHARSET=utf8;

CREATETABLE mantis_custom_field_string_table ( field_idINTEGERNOTNULLDEFAULT 0, bug_idINTEGERNOTNULLDEFAULT 0, valueVARCHAR(255) NOTNULLDEFAULT'', PRIMARYKEY (field_id, bug_id)

)ENGINE=MyISAM DEFAULT CHARSET=utf8;

ALTERTABLE mantis_custom_field_string_table ADDINDEX idx_custom_field_bug (bug_id);

CREATETABLE mantis_custom_field_table ( idINTEGERNOTNULL AUTO_INCREMENT, nameVARCHAR(64) NOTNULLDEFAULT'', typeSMALLINTNOTNULLDEFAULT 0,

possible_valuesVARCHAR(255) NOTNULLDEFAULT'',

default_valueVARCHAR(255) NOTNULLDEFAULT'', valid_regexpVARCHAR(255) NOTNULLDEFAULT'', access_level_rSMALLINTNOTNULLDEFAULT 0, access_level_rwSMALLINTNOTNULLDEFAULT 0, length_minINTEGERNOTNULLDEFAULT 0, length_maxINTEGERNOTNULLDEFAULT 0,

advanced TINYINT NOTNULLDEFAULT'0', require_report TINYINT NOTNULLDEFAULT'0', require_update TINYINT NOTNULLDEFAULT'0', display_report TINYINT NOTNULLDEFAULT'0', display_update TINYINT NOTNULLDEFAULT'1', require_resolved TINYINT NOTNULLDEFAULT'0', display_resolved TINYINT NOTNULLDEFAULT'0', display_closed TINYINT NOTNULLDEFAULT'0', require_closed TINYINT NOTNULLDEFAULT'0', PRIMARYKEY (id)

)ENGINE=MyISAM DEFAULT CHARSET=utf8;

ALTERTABLE mantis_custom_field_table ADDINDEX idx_custom_field_name (name);

CREATETABLE mantis_filters_table (

idINTEGER UNSIGNED NOTNULL AUTO_INCREMENT, user_idINTEGERNOTNULLDEFAULT 0, project_idINTEGERNOTNULLDEFAULT 0,

is_public TINYINT DEFAULTNULL, nameVARCHAR(64) NOTNULLDEFAULT'',

filter_string LONGTEXT NOTNULL, PRIMARYKEY (id)

)ENGINE=MyISAM DEFAULT CHARSET=utf8;

CREATETABLE mantis_news_table (

idINTEGER UNSIGNED NOTNULL AUTO_INCREMENT, project_idINTEGER UNSIGNED NOTNULLDEFAULT 0, poster_idINTEGER UNSIGNED NOTNULLDEFAULT 0,

date_posted DATETIME NOTNULLDEFAULT'1970-01-01 00:00:01', last_modified DATETIME NOTNULLDEFAULT'1970-01-01 00:00:01', view_stateSMALLINTNOTNULLDEFAULT 10,

announcement TINYINT NOTNULLDEFAULT'0', headlineVARCHAR(64) NOTNULLDEFAULT'', body LONGTEXT NOTNULL, PRIMARYKEY (id)

)ENGINE=MyISAM DEFAULT CHARSET=utf8;

CREATETABLE mantis_project_category_table (

project_idINTEGER UNSIGNED NOTNULLDEFAULT 0, categoryVARCHAR(64) NOTNULLDEFAULT'', user_idINTEGER UNSIGNED NOTNULLDEFAULT 0, PRIMARYKEY (project_id, category) )ENGINE=MyISAM DEFAULT CHARSET=utf8;

CREATETABLE mantis_project_file_table ( idINTEGER UNSIGNED NOTNULL AUTO_INCREMENT, project_idINTEGER UNSIGNED NOTNULLDEFAULT 0, titleVARCHAR(250) NOTNULLDEFAULT'', descriptionVARCHAR(250) NOTNULLDEFAULT'', diskfileVARCHAR(250) NOTNULLDEFAULT'', filenameVARCHAR(250) NOTNULLDEFAULT'', folderVARCHAR(250) NOTNULLDEFAULT'', filesizeINTEGERNOTNULLDEFAULT 0,

file_typeVARCHAR(250) NOTNULLDEFAULT'',

date_added DATETIME NOTNULLDEFAULT'1970-01-01 00:00:01', content LONGBLOB NOTNULL, PRIMARYKEY (id)

)ENGINE=MyISAM DEFAULT CHARSET=utf8;

CREATETABLE mantis_project_hierarchy_table ( child_idINTEGER UNSIGNED NOTNULL, parent_idINTEGER UNSIGNED NOTNULL )ENGINE=MyISAM DEFAULT CHARSET=utf8;

CREATETABLE mantis_project_table (

idINTEGER UNSIGNED NOTNULL AUTO_INCREMENT, nameVARCHAR(128) NOTNULLDEFAULT'', statusSMALLINTNOTNULLDEFAULT 10,

enabled TINYINT NOTNULLDEFAULT'1', view_stateSMALLINTNOTNULLDEFAULT 10, access_minSMALLINTNOTNULLDEFAULT 10, file_pathVARCHAR(250) NOTNULLDEFAULT'', description LONGTEXT NOTNULL, PRIMARYKEY (id)

)ENGINE=MyISAM DEFAULT CHARSET=utf8;

ALTERTABLE mantis_project_table ADDINDEX idx_project_id (id);

ALTERTABLE mantis_project_table ADDUNIQUEINDEX idx_project_name (name);

ALTERTABLE mantis_project_table ADDINDEX idx_project_view (view_state);

CREATETABLE mantis_project_user_list_table ( project_idINTEGER UNSIGNED NOTNULLDEFAULT 0, user_idINTEGER UNSIGNED NOTNULLDEFAULT 0, access_levelSMALLINTNOTNULLDEFAULT 10, PRIMARYKEY (project_id, user_id) )ENGINE=MyISAM DEFAULT CHARSET=utf8;

ALTERTABLE mantis_project_user_list_table ADDINDEX idx_project_user (user_id);

CREATETABLE mantis_project_version_table ( idINTEGERNOTNULL AUTO_INCREMENT,

project_idINTEGER UNSIGNED NOTNULLDEFAULT 0, versionVARCHAR(64) NOTNULLDEFAULT'',

date_order DATETIME NOTNULLDEFAULT'1970-01-01 00:00:01', description LONGTEXT NOTNULL,

released TINYINT NOTNULLDEFAULT'1', PRIMARYKEY (id)

)ENGINE=MyISAM DEFAULT CHARSET=utf8;

ALTERTABLE mantis_project_version_table ADDUNIQUEINDEX idx_project_version (project_id, version);

CREATETABLE mantis_sponsorship_table ( idINTEGERNOTNULL AUTO_INCREMENT, bug_idINTEGERNOTNULLDEFAULT 0, user_idINTEGERNOTNULLDEFAULT 0, amountINTEGERNOTNULLDEFAULT 0, logoVARCHAR(128) NOTNULLDEFAULT'', urlVARCHAR(128) NOTNULLDEFAULT'',

paid TINYINT NOTNULLDEFAULT'0',

date_submitted DATETIME NOTNULLDEFAULT'1970-01-01 00:00:01', last_updated DATETIME NOTNULLDEFAULT'1970-01-01 00:00:01', PRIMARYKEY (id)

)ENGINE=MyISAM DEFAULT CHARSET=utf8;

ALTERTABLE mantis_sponsorship_table ADDINDEX idx_sponsorship_bug_id (bug_id);

ALTERTABLE mantis_sponsorship_table ADDINDEX idx_sponsorship_user_id (user_id);

CREATETABLE mantis_tokens_table ( idINTEGERNOTNULL AUTO_INCREMENT, ownerINTEGERNOTNULL, typeINTEGERNOTNULL,

timestamp DATETIME NOTNULL,